Nuclear power renaissance clearly centered in the Oak Ridge region

The latest publication to write about it is E&E News by Politico.

The article begins as follows:

“Nestled amid the foothills of the Appalachian Mountains, this sprawling town of 33,000 was built from scratch to be the Manhattan Project’s headquarters. Now it’s primed to host the country’s nuclear power renaissance. “There’s a critical mass here,” said Alan Lowe, Executive Director of the American Museum of Science and Energy in Oak Ridge.

The article was published recently in E&E News by Politico, one of a handful of publications under the Politico brand. Founded 25 years ago, E&E News dives into the ever-evolving landscape of energy and the environment to keep professionals informed, empowered, and a step ahead with original, compelling, and non-partisan journalism.

Lowe goes on to talk about “the 154 nuclear companies (that) call the area home, turning a birthplace of the Atomic Age into the incubation chamber for America’s potential nuclear revival.” He also cites organizations like the East Tennessee Economic Council (ETEC) as making a difference.
